Chris Wahl, MA, MCC
As an executive coach with a background in organization development, Chris offers executive and leadership coaching to leaders in many industries. Her practice focuses on helping executives generate enlivening change and develop leaders who can help execute their vision. She has studied how adults develop, and is certified as a developmental coach. She is a certified scorer for the Maturity Assessment Profile, which determines a leader’s stage of development, and which is one of the most interesting assessments available for leaders. As creator/founder of the Leadership Coaching Program at Georgetown University, Chris was the first to envision coach training that focused on developing leaders. She continues to teach at Georgetown, and at George Mason University. She co-authored Be Your Own Coach, and co-edited, On Becoming a Leadership Coach. She has published several articles and been interviewed by NPR, Forbes, and The Washington Post.
